Anthony Albert (Tony) Franco, 97, passed away on October 10, 2022, surrounded by family, after a recent diagnosis of colon cancer. He lived in Briarcliff Manor for almost 53 years. He was born in Philadelphia, PA on July 16, 1925. He graduated from the University of Pennsylvania in 1949, after serving in the US Navy during WWII for three years, and worked for IBM for 40 years in Honduras, Mexico, and finally Armonk, NY.

He was a long-time member of Sleepy Hollow Country Club, and had also been a member of the Saw Mill River Club, Club Fit, the International Lawn Tennis Club (IC) and Orange Lawn.

Other than his family, Tony's greatest joy was found on the tennis court. A life-long player, he won two Central American Men's Singles championships; represented Mexico twice in the Stevens Cup Matches. He achieved #1 rankings in the Eastern section at least once in every age group from the 50's - 85's, a total of 20 times. Tony won 45 National Championships, 21 in singles and 24 in doubles. He represented the U.S. in International play, in the Bitsy Grant Cup (2001) and the Gardnar Molloy Cup (2005-2009) with a record of 17-2 in singles. He also won 4 doubles ITF World Championships with his friend, Grady Nichols. Tony's greatest victory, however, was winning the ITF 80+ World Singles Championship in 2006 in Antalya, Turkey. Tony was inducted into the Westchester County Sports Hall of Fame (1989) and The Eastern Tennis Hall of Fame (2010).
